Abstract
The response of subjects suffering from cancer to MAPK inhibitors is dramatically impaired by secondary resistances and rapid relapse. So far, the molecular mechanisms driving these resistances are not completely understood. The inventors show that expression of 10 SLITRK6 (SLIT and NTRK-like family, member 6) is induced by a MAPK inhibitor (e.g. Vemurafenib) and the inhibition of its induction in presence of the MAPK inhibitor induces synthetic lethality. Thus, the only inhibition of SLITRK6 by an inhibitor of activity or expression should potentiate the antitumor effect of the MAPK inhibitors and avoid the emergence of a resistance to those compounds. Furthermore the specific expression of 15 SLITRK6 also paves the way of strategies based on depletion of the residual cancer cells by targeting them with anti-SLITRK6 antibodies capable of mediating ADCC or antibody-drug conjugates binding to SLITRK6.
